Cygnus is the way the signal is processed, so every patch will be Cygnus.
The preset is a set of parameter. A preset made for ares could differ from a cygnus one both in parameter and value: if you search in the release note you will find new or removed parameter references. Moreover, same value of a parameter may have a different impact in different firmware, so auditioning your preset to adjust the sound to your taste, and save them.

This problem was a headache for me also.
I have fixed it.
My solution is, step by step:
1- back up of presets, cabs, layouts of the firmware I am going to leave (I skip system backup, not necessary for this)
2- reset system parameters (FM3 unit>Setup>Utilities>Reset page>ResetSystemParameters)
3-install new firmware
4-after rebooting the unit, reset system parameters again
5-set manually again all system parameters (only import layouts)

This solution has worked for me perfectly for 3.03 beta1, 4.00 beta 1 and 4.00 beta 2. In fact, I will always install firmware in this way.

It's important to remark step 5: if you import system parameters from a backup, the problems can be imported too. So it's important to set manually the system configuration.

Finally: to do step 5 it's important to have a list of what parameters must be changed. Not necessary to have a list of all parameters of the unit (a lot). It's only necessary to have the list of what parameters must be changed from default values (when reset system parameters all parameters are set to default).

I did the list like this:
First, I took a picture of every page of the setup menu in the unit (scrolling down also for the largest pages). These pictures show the parameters you want to have in the system. So, these pictures are taken before resetting the system parameters.
Once I had the pictures, I reset the system parameters, and I navigated again through the menus of the unit and compare them with the pictures. The parameters that are not coincident is the parameters you should be aware to change from default values. You can write that parameters in a list, and/or highlight in the pictures.

Once this list is done, you just have to focus on that list parameters when doing step 5 every time you reset the system.

Example: In I/O menu, Audio page, I only change the USB 3,4 Playback destination to Output 2. This is the picture I have, with a red rectangle around the parameter:
